Physical activity and fitness with age, sex, and ethnic differences: Data suggests that people tend to engage in less pa as they get older. Moreover, estimates show that fewer than 5% of the population are active at recommended levels: Should do 60 minutes or more of physical activity daily: It is very important to encourage young people to participate in physical activities that are appropriate for their age, that are enjoyable, and that offer variety. Although often assumed, the evidence suggests that the relationship between childhood and adulthood physical activity is poor. Sport participation, however, may be more strongly associated with the relationship between childhood and adulthood physical activity. Small ethnic differences in pa have also been reported; cultural factors may play a role: I. e. how is pa and fitness valued, religious norms, recreational availability, etc. Recommendations: children and adolescents, should perform 60 minutes of daily physical activity.
